Title :
The study for electric power equipment supplier evaluation based on rough set and fuzzy grey incidence cluster analysis

Abstract :
Supplier evaluation is a precondition to choose good electric power suppliers, based on analyzing existing evaluation methods of suppliers, this paper establishes evaluation index system of suppliers integrative strength, puts forward a integrative evaluation model based on integrating rough set with fuzzy grey incidence cluster analysis, makes the results of the evaluation more objective, scientific and precise. Finally, we illustrate the application in choosing electric power suppliers by an example.
